CFN99074 | Taraxasterol Taraxasterol has anti-inflammatory, anti- tumor-promoting , anti-endotoxic shock and anti-allergic asthma activities. It inhibited NO, IFN-γ, PGE(2), TNF-α, IL-1β and IL-6 production. |
CFN99543 | Narirutin Citrus narirutin fraction (CNF), contained 75% of narirutin, co-administration of CNF with alcohol can alleviate alcohol induced liver damage through preventing lipid formation, protecting antioxidant system and suppressing productions of pro-inflammatory cytokines. Narirutin has anti-inflammatory effect in a murine model of allergic eosinophilic airway inflammation, the mechanism is likely to be associated with a reduction in the OVA-induced increases of IL-4 and IgE. |
CFN99615 | 3-O-Methylquercetin tetraacetate Quercetin 3-O-methyl ether is a potent phosphodiesterase (PDE)3/4 inhibitor, it has potential for treating asthma against ovalbumin-induced airway hyperresponsiveness. |
CFN99575 | Licochalcone A Licochalcone A is an estrogenic flavanoid extracted from licorice root, showing antimalarial, antileishmanial, anticancer, anti-inflammatory, antibacterial and antiviral activities. It could be a promising strategy in treating osteoporotic weight-bearing bones fractures with defects, and be a useful compound for the development of antibacterial agents for the preservation of foods containing high concentrations of salts and proteases, in which cationic peptides might be less effective. |
CFN99616 | 3-O-Methylquercetin 3-O-Methylquercetin is a selective and competitive PDE3/PDE4 inhibitor, and inhibits PDE3 than PDE4 with a low K(m) value; it inhibits total cAMP- and cGMP-phosphodiesterase (PDE) of guinea pig trachealis at low concentrations. 3-O-Methylquercetin has antiviral, anti-inflammatory and bronchodilating effects, and has the potential for use in the treatment of asthma at a dose without affecting blood pressure. |
